Digital biz roadshow in Permatang targets 200 participants — Exco

By Zareef Muzammil

SHAH ALAM, July 12 — The Selangor Digital Entrepreneur Roadshow is targeting 200 traders in the Permatang state constituency for the programme when it takes place on August 6.

Its state assemblyman Rozana Zainal Abidin said the programme, held in cooperation with the Selangor Information Technology and Digital Economy Corporation (Sidec) will expose participants to strategies on how to generate additional income via online business.

“This roadshow will bring the main players including Lazada, Shopee and J&T to open the minds of traders, to add the existing space from physical trading to online trading.

“It also indirectly provides an opportunity to traders to get more sales than before,” she said when contacted by SelangorKini.

At the same time, Rozana admitted that many traders have yet to move to digital trading, despite the availability of the platform.

“In the meeting with Sidec, I was informed that 50 per cent of entrepreneurs still have not been exposed to digital trading, based on the previous series of roadshows in the constituency and other districts before this.

“This is a high percentage, and we must bring about awareness so traders can change their business strategies. This does not mean they have to cease conducting physical business, but instead is an addition of another sector which is online,” she said.

Since its introduction in 2020, the roadshow will visit every district until this September.

The programme is an important instrument in helping entrepreneurs penetrate the international market in an easier and faster manner.

Asides from Lazada, Shopee and J&T, the roadshow will also include working partners like PG Mall, EasyStore, Dropee, Yayasan Hijrah Selangor, the Selangor Digital E-Supply Chain, and the Companies Commission of Malaysia.
